K834376 is an FDA 510(k) clearance for the FILTRARE TM ALLVENT TM. Classified as Filter, Infusion Line (product code FPB), Class II - Special Controls.

Submitted by Alltek, Inc. (Walker, US). The FDA issued a Cleared decision on May 11, 1984 after a review of 149 days - within the typical 510(k) review window.

This device falls under the General Hospital FDA review panel, regulated under 21 CFR 880.5440 - the FDA general hospital device framework. The Traditional 510(k) pathway establishes clearance through substantial equivalence to a legally marketed predicate device, without requiring clinical trial data.

What this classification means

Class II devices require demonstration of substantial equivalence to a legally marketed predicate device. This pathway does not require clinical trials - it relies on engineering equivalence and performance data. Most General Hospital devices follow this clearance model.
